[libosmo-sccp] 03/05: Get rid of some lintians. Improved copyright

Ruben Undheim rubund-guest at moszumanska.debian.org
Fri Feb 5 16:52:31 UTC 2016


This is an automated email from the git hooks/post-receive script.

rubund-guest pushed a commit to branch master
in repository libosmo-sccp.

commit 60e679bc606410b162a99057abf00432bf4b2a47
Author: Ruben Undheim <ruben.undheim at gmail.com>
Date:   Fri Feb 5 17:46:22 2016 +0100

    Get rid of some lintians.
    Improved copyright
---
 debian/copyright                               | 68 ++++++++++++--------------
 debian/patches/01_make_library_shared.patch    | 26 +---------
 debian/patches/02_set_version_explicitly.patch | 26 +---------
 3 files changed, 36 insertions(+), 84 deletions(-)

diff --git a/debian/copyright b/debian/copyright
index 97328f2..abf25ac 100644
--- a/debian/copyright
+++ b/debian/copyright
@@ -1,36 +1,32 @@
-This work was packaged for Debian by:
-
-    Harald Welte <laforge at gnumonks.org> on Tue, 24 Aug 2010 10:55:04 +0200
-
-It was downloaded from:
-
-    git://git.osmocom.org/libosmo-sccp.git
-
-Upstream Author(s):
-
-    Holger Hans Peter Freyther <zecke at selfish.org>
-
-Copyright:
-
-    Copyright (C) 2009-2010 Holger Hans Peter Freyther <zecke at selfish.org>
-    Copyright (C) 2009-2010 On-Waves
-
-License:
-
-    GNU General Public License, Version 2 or later
-
-The Debian packaging is:
-
-    Copyright (C) 2010 Harald Welte <laforge at gnumonks.org>
-
-# Please chose a license for your packaging work. If the program you package
-# uses a mainstream license, using the same license is the safest choice.
-# Please avoid to pick license terms that are more restrictive than the
-# packaged work, as it may make Debian's contributions unacceptable upstream.
-# If you just want it to be GPL version 3, leave the following lines in.
-
-and is licensed under the GPL version 3,
-see "/usr/share/common-licenses/GPL-3".
-
-# Please also look if there are files or directories which have a
-# different copyright/license attached and list them here.
+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
+Upstream-Name: libopen-sccp
+Source: http://cgit.osmocom.org/libosmo-sccp/
+
+Files: *
+Copyright: 2009-2010  Holger Hans Peter Freyther <zecke at selfish.org>
+           2009-2010  On-Waves
+           2010       Harald Welte <laforge at gnumonks.org>
+License: GPL-2+
+
+Files: debian/*
+Copyright: 2010-2015  Harald Welte <laforge at gnumonks.org>
+           2016       Ruben Undheim <ruben.undheim at gmail.com>
+License: GPL-2+
+
+
+License: GPL-2+
+ This package is free software: you can redistribute it and/or modify it
+ under the terms of the GNU General Public License as published by
+ the Free Software Foundation, either version 2 of the License, or (at
+ your option) any later version.
+ .
+ This program is distributed in the hope that it will be useful, but
+ W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Y
+ or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U General Public License
+ for more details.
+ .
+ You should have received a copy of the GNU General Public License
+ along with this program.  If not, see <http://www.gnu.org/licenses/>.
+ .
+ On Debian systems, the complete text of the GNU General Public
+ License version 2.1 can be found in "/usr/share/common-licenses/GPL-2".
diff --git a/debian/patches/01_make_library_shared.patch b/debian/patches/01_make_library_shared.patch
index f54cd7e..cf04e55 100644
--- a/debian/patches/01_make_library_shared.patch
+++ b/debian/patches/01_make_library_shared.patch
@@ -1,28 +1,6 @@
-Description: <short summary of the patch>
- TODO: Put a short summary on the line above and replace this paragraph
- with a longer explanation of this change. Complete the meta-information
- with other relevant fields (see below for details). To make it easier, the
- information below has been extracted from the changelog. Adjust it or drop
- it.
- .
- libosmo-sccp (0.7.0-1) unstable; urgency=low
- .
-   * Initial release (Closes: #813294)
+Description: Upstream only delivers static libraries. This patch changes these
+ to shared libraries.
 Author: Ruben Undheim <ruben.undheim at gmail.com>
-Bug-Debian: https://bugs.debian.org/813294
-
----
-The information above should follow the Patch Tagging Guidelines, please
-checkout http://dep.debian.net/deps/dep3/ to learn about the format. Here
-are templates for supplementary fields that you might want to add:
-
-Origin: <vendor|upstream|other>, <url of original patch>
-Bug: <url in upstream bugtracker>
-Bug-Debian: https://bugs.debian.org/<bugnumber>
-Bug-Ubuntu: https://launchpad.net/bugs/<bugnumber>
-Forwarded: <no|not-needed|url proving that it has been forwarded>
-Reviewed-By: <name and email of someone who approved the patch>
-Last-Update: <YYYY-MM-DD>
 
 Index: libosmo-sccp/src/Makefile.am
 ===================================================================
diff --git a/debian/patches/02_set_version_explicitly.patch b/debian/patches/02_set_version_explicitly.patch
index dae1430..9cfa27e 100644
--- a/debian/patches/02_set_version_explicitly.patch
+++ b/debian/patches/02_set_version_explicitly.patch
@@ -1,28 +1,6 @@
-Description: <short summary of the patch>
- TODO: Put a short summary on the line above and replace this paragraph
- with a longer explanation of this change. Complete the meta-information
- with other relevant fields (see below for details). To make it easier, the
- information below has been extracted from the changelog. Adjust it or drop
- it.
- .
- libosmo-sccp (0.7.0-1) unstable; urgency=low
- .
-   * Initial release (Closes: #813294)
+Description: Make sure the version is set correctly and therefore not depend
+ on some git command to find a "dirty" version.
 Author: Ruben Undheim <ruben.undheim at gmail.com>
-Bug-Debian: https://bugs.debian.org/813294
-
----
-The information above should follow the Patch Tagging Guidelines, please
-checkout http://dep.debian.net/deps/dep3/ to learn about the format. Here
-are templates for supplementary fields that you might want to add:
-
-Origin: <vendor|upstream|other>, <url of original patch>
-Bug: <url in upstream bugtracker>
-Bug-Debian: https://bugs.debian.org/<bugnumber>
-Bug-Ubuntu: https://launchpad.net/bugs/<bugnumber>
-Forwarded: <no|not-needed|url proving that it has been forwarded>
-Reviewed-By: <name and email of someone who approved the patch>
-Last-Update: <YYYY-MM-DD>
 
 --- libosmo-sccp-0.7.0.orig/configure.ac
 +++ libosmo-sccp-0.7.0/configure.ac

-- 
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/debian-science/packages/libosmo-sccp.git



More information about the debian-science-commits mailing list